In Illinois, attorneys that work with a backup fee basis only obtain repayment if they successfully win an accident case via a negotiation or a trial decision. This technique means that you do not require to pay any kind of in advance Cell Phone Records costs or per hour prices; the lawyer's payment is based on accomplishing a favorable legal result. Hiring an accident legal representative shouldn't add to your stress and anxiety-- it ought to relieve it. Most personal injury legal representatives charge a contingency charge in between 33% and 40% of the negotiation or award. This charge is only applicable if you win or settle your accident insurance claim. The percentage can vary depending on the intricacy of your situation and the legal representative's experience.

Fixed-rate legal charges are when a legal representative and client agree to a level fee for a particular solution. One of the most powerful feature of the contingency fee is that it makes your lawyer a true partner in your recuperation. Their success is linked straight to your success, producing the greatest possible reward to fight for every dollar you are entitled to.
